What makes a city truly unforgettable? Is it the attractions, the restaurants, or the people who bring it to life?


Meet Wendy Roberts

Wendy Roberts has spent more than 25 years helping destinations tell their stories. As President and CEO of Travel Santa Ana, she believes the best places aren't defined by famous landmarks, but by local businesses, authentic experiences, and the people who make visitors feel welcome.


What Makes a City Memorable

When people think about travel, they often picture famous landmarks, beaches, or bucket-list attractions. Wendy Roberts believes those things are only part of the story.


The destinations people remember most are often shaped by experiences that can't be found in a guidebook. A conversation with a local restaurant owner. A neighborhood coffee shop. A mural tucked away on a side street. The feeling of discovering something that feels authentic.


According to Wendy, great destinations are built through:

  • Local restaurants and independent businesses

  • Arts, culture, and community events

  • Welcoming residents who create memorable experiences

  • Unique neighborhoods with their own personality

  • Opportunities to discover something unexpected


Those experiences are what turn a trip into a lasting memory and often become the reason people return.


Why Every Destination Needs a Story

Before becoming President and CEO of Travel Santa Ana, Wendy spent years working in public relations and marketing. That background shaped how she approaches destination marketing today.


Every city has restaurants, hotels, and attractions. What separates one destination from another is the story it tells.


For Wendy, successful destination marketing means helping visitors understand what makes a community unique rather than simply listing things to do. It's about showcasing the people, businesses, history, and culture that give a place its identity.


Strong destination storytelling focuses on:

  • The people behind local businesses

  • Authentic experiences visitors can't find elsewhere

  • Community events that bring neighborhoods together

  • Local history and culture

  • Creating an emotional connection before someone even arrives

When travelers feel connected to a destination's story, they're more likely to choose it over somewhere else.


Be a Tourist in Your Own Backyard

One of Wendy's simplest pieces of advice applies whether you're traveling across the country or staying close to home.


Explore your own community with fresh eyes. Many people spend hours researching destinations halfway around the world while overlooking incredible restaurants, museums, festivals, and small businesses just a few miles away.


Being a tourist in your own backyard can help you:

  • Discover businesses you've never visited

  • Support your local economy

  • Appreciate your community in a new way

  • Find experiences you would normally overlook

  • Build stronger connections with the people around you

Sometimes the best travel experiences aren't found on an airplane. They're waiting in your own city.


Trust Your Gut and Your Journey

Looking back on her career, Wendy didn't follow a perfectly planned path. Her journey took her from public relations into destination marketing before eventually leading Travel Santa Ana.


One lesson has stayed with her through every career move: trust your gut.

Opportunities don't always arrive exactly as expected, and careers rarely follow a straight line. Being open to change, trusting your instincts, and continuing to learn can often lead to opportunities you never planned for.


For anyone building a career, Wendy's advice is simple:

  • Trust your instincts

  • Stay curious

  • Be open to unexpected opportunities

  • Learn from every experience

  • Focus on the relationships you build along the way

Whether you're leading an organization, growing a business, or planning your next trip, those principles can open doors you never expected.
